Transaction 503c17db5f77367fb4c39229732998c384ad73a7e007779764ece2a0c30efda9
1 Input
2 Outputs
- 503c17db5f77367fb4c39229732998c384ad73a7e007779764ece2a0c30efda9:0
- 503c17db5f77367fb4c39229732998c384ad73a7e007779764ece2a0c30efda9:1
value 675477
address 17r7Lfq3j5XtWNgseWvDLXHxgqkS9pabZh
value 2775312
address 1JZnTv4NogZf1LwYn2AZzQ8b22fEe8kuHZ